Transform Your Space with George Home's Marie Antoinette Inspired Collection

Elegant bedroom showcasing George Home French Fancy Collection bedding.

Discover the French Fancy Collection: A Sweet Home Décor Treat

As summer fades and autumn approaches, home décor enthusiasts are eagerly anticipating the latest trends to refresh their interiors. One exciting collection that's turning heads is George Home's colorful range inspired by Marie Antoinette, aptly named the French Fancy Collection. With its whimsical designs and pastel palette, every piece looks good enough to eat and adds a delightful charm to any living space.

Why French Inspired Décor is Trending

This collection embraces a playful take on classic French style, featuring vibrant pastel motifs and ornamental glassware. The trend is all about joie de vivre, capturing the spirit of indulgence and enjoyment in home design. With its sugary sweet aesthetics, the French Fancy Collection invites you to transform your home into a picturesque world reminiscent of Parisian patisseries.

The Standout Pieces to Elevate Your Home

Now, let’s dive into the top six favorite picks from George Home that you absolutely need in your trolley:

  • Striped Ruched Frill Duvet Set (£20): This stunning ruched bedding offers a luxurious look at an affordable price. The butter yellow shade is on-trend and brightens up any bedroom.
  • Love You Bye Slogan Cushion (£12): This cheeky cushion makes a fantastic statement piece, perfect for sparking fun conversations among guests.
  • Painted Bows Easycare Duvet Set (£25): Featuring adorable dainty bows, this bedding set is perfect for all ages, bringing a touch of whimsy to your personal sanctuary.
  • Pink Stacking Ribbed Mixer Glass - Set of 4 (£15): These charming pink glasses are stackable, making them both functional and stylish, a must-have for any home entertainer.
  • Whimsical Wall Art (£30): Adding originality through art helps tie the whole décor together, and whimsical pieces can inspire joy and creativity.
  • Ornamental Glassware Set (£40): Ideal for hosting, this set adds elegance and class to your dining experience.

Making This Style Work for You

Integrating the French Fancy aesthetic can be effortless. Pair pastels with soft whites to create calm and inviting spaces, or mix with bolder patterns for a more dramatic effect. The beauty of this collection lies in its versatility and unique charm.

Future Trends in Home Décor

Looking ahead, it’s clear that home décor will continue to embrace themes of escapism and playfulness. Decor that evokes memories from the past while providing comfort and joy will remain on-trend as homeowners seek to create spaces that reflect their personalities. This new approach, similar to the French Fancy Collection, emphasizes home as a sanctuary filled with beauty and inspiration.

Why You Should Ditch the Beige and Embrace Pattern Curtains Today!

Update Why Pattern Curtains Are Worth a Second Look Patterns can transform a room, adding a layer of visual interest that draws the eye and creates an inviting ambience. Laurence Llewelyn-Bowen, the flamboyant designer known for his bold interior choices, stresses the importance of embracing patterns in your home decor. He suggests that window treatments are unfairly overlooked as a canvas for creativity. Instead of blending in, they could serve as the focal point of a room. Breaking Down the Fear of Patterns If you're like many homeowners, the thought of pattern curtains can be intimidating. You may worry about overwhelming the space or conflicting with existing decor. However, Laurence points out that adding patterns can actually create harmony and richness, rather than chaos. "Stop confirming to bland choices," he says. Incorporating prints and bold colors is a chance to express your personality and make a space feel uniquely yours. The Rise of Bold Designs in Home Decor In recent years, furniture and decor styles have embraced daring patterns and designs. The successful collections from brands like Habitat and John Lewis indicate a shift in consumer preferences toward more vibrant and intricate home elements. The House Llewelyn-Bowen Legacy Collection, for example, showcases an exciting assortment of 79 pieces, including memorable prints that have been reimagined to suit modern aesthetics. How to Choose the Right Patterns When contemplating patterned curtains, it's vital to consider how they will interact with the rest of your decor. Choose patterns that not only resonate with your taste but also complement your existing color scheme and furniture style. Additionally, balance is essential. Pair bold curtains with minimalistic furniture or accents to avoid overcrowding your space. Maximizing Impact with Patterns The beauty of using pattern curtains lies in their versatility. They can evoke a sense of coziness while also providing a burst of energy to your living spaces. Laurence suggests rethinking how we view curtains: instead of merely functional pieces, they should be exciting design elements that offer visual pleasure both day and night. "A hit of pattern in a space is what it needs right now," he points out. Visual Examples to Inspire You Images of rooms featuring the new House Llewelyn-Bowen collection show the power of patterned curtains. For example, the Menagerie Artois design brings a vibrant botanical theme that feels fresh and lively. Meanwhile, the Gwendoline Printed Damask offers elegance with a historical nod. These examples serve as a reminder that the right fabric choices can elevate any space. Pushing Boundaries in Home Decor Interior design should be fun and evocative, not limited to conventional standards. By daring to choose pattern curtains, you embrace creativity and assertiveness in your home. By making such bold choices, you not only refresh your living space but also add value as trends increasingly lean towards unique and personalized home aesthetics. Consider This Before Making Your Purchase Before you dive into selecting new curtains, think about your lifestyle and how you use space. Do you often entertain guests? Opt for a bolder pattern. Are you creating a cozy nook for reading? A softer print may be more pleasing. This careful consideration, alongside expert opinions like Laurence’s, can guide you toward a choice that enhances your environment. Final Thoughts for Home Decor Enthusiasts Home decor, particularly elements like curtains, should reflect who you are. Laurence Llewelyn-Bowen urges us to be brave and take chances with our home choices. With the rise in popularity of bold designs, now might be the perfect time to reimagine your windows. Jump in, embrace your personal style, and start creating a home that tells your story. As you explore patterned curtains for your space, remember that home décor is not just about aesthetics; it’s about creating a sanctuary that nurtures and inspires you. Be bold, be adventurous, and allow patterns to breathe new life into your home!

Scottish Greens Propose Ban on Evictions for New Tenants

Update The Scottish Greens Propose New Tenant Protections In an effort to overhaul tenant rights in Scotland, the Scottish Green Party is advocating for legislation that would prohibit landlords from evicting tenants during the first year of their tenancy. This initiative aims to provide renters with greater stability in a housing market that is increasingly viewed as precarious. According to Maggie Chapman, the party's MSP leading the charge, the current system disproportionately favors landlords over tenants, leaving many at risk of sudden eviction and destabilization. Understanding the Proposal's Key Components Under the proposed amendment to the upcoming Housing (Scotland) Bill, landlords would have to provide a minimum notice period of four months before any eviction. This is a significant increase from the current notice period, which ranges from one to three months, depending on the circumstances. Investors would also face restrictions if they intend to sell the property or wish to move in family members, mandating they wait for a full year after a tenant moves in. Challenges Facing the Property Market The push for these measures comes against the backdrop of a broader housing emergency in Scotland. With rising rents and a limited supply of affordable housing, many families and individuals are finding it increasingly difficult to secure long-term housing stability. Chapman emphasized the urgency of these changes, arguing that the current system leaves tenants vulnerable and unable to make meaningful plans for their future. Comparing Scotland's Measures to Those in England This legislative proposal holds particular significance as it aims to offer protections similar to those being rolled out in England. Tenants south of the border are beginning to receive new rights, and Chapman is calling for the Scottish Government to step up and ensure that Scots do not fall short of the same protections. This comparison highlights a growing recognition across the UK that tenant security is a vital component of housing policy. Potential Implications for Property Investors For property owners and investors, the proposed legislation presents both challenges and opportunities. While the restrictions on eviction could limit landlords' flexibility in managing their properties, there is also a chance that increased security for tenants could lead to a more stable rental market. Investors who prioritize long-term tenant relationships may find this legislation aligns with their business goals, resulting in lower turnover rates and more reliable rental income. Reactions from Stakeholders in the Housing Market Responses to the proposed changes have been mixed. Advocates for tenant rights applaud the Scottish Greens for pushing for stronger protections, arguing that the legislation could significantly improve living conditions for many renters. Conversely, some landlords express concern over the potential financial impacts of such policies, fearing they may lead to reduced investment in rental properties. Looking Ahead: The Future of Housing Legislation in Scotland As discussions on the Housing (Scotland) Bill progress, the dialogue surrounding tenant rights and landlord responsibilities is expected to remain at the forefront of Scottish public policy. With the housing crisis continuing to affect communities across Scotland, the importance of finding solutions that benefit both tenants and landlords cannot be overstated. The Scottish Greens' proposal is a call to action for all stakeholders to engage in conversations that prioritize security and stability in the housing market. Unlocking Home Buying Secrets: Your Essential Mortgage Market Update

Update Understanding Today's Mortgage Market In the current landscape of mortgage options, the latest podcast episode from the ESPC Property Show brings fresh insights that are invaluable for homebuyers, sellers, and property investors eager to navigate the Dumfries market effectively. Joined by experts David Lauder and Lisa Bell, hosts Paul and Megan delve into key developments regarding mortgage rates and lending practices. Mortgage Rates: A Positive Shift Recently, lenders have shown responsiveness to the recent Bank of England base rate cuts, causing average mortgage interest rates for 2-year and 5-year fixed deals to settle around 4 to 4.5 percent. This is good news for homebuyers, signaling that the worst may be over for those looking to secure favorable loan terms. However, experts caution prospective borrowers: it's essential to look beyond just the headline rates. The advertised deals can be misleading, often coupled with high product fees or stringent deposit requirements. Increased Borrowing Capacity The easing of stress tests means that borrowers can now access significantly greater funds compared to just six months prior. Historically capped at 4 to 4.5 times income, lending multiples in some cases have surged up to 5 to 6 times. This change is especially beneficial under initiatives like Nationwide's "Helping Hand" scheme. Though the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) maintains strict regulations to prevent reckless lending, these adjustments present exciting opportunities for first-time buyers and those looking to move up the property ladder. Buying and Moving: Accessibility on the Rise With homes now selling closer to their Home Report valuations, buyers face reduced risks during competitive bidding processes. This balance means that while sellers may receive less in terms of equity, the increased borrowing capacity makes upgrading homes more manageable. The market's transition to a more reasonable state contrasts vividly with the frenetic pace observed in previous years, offering an inviting environment for movers. The Importance of Strategic Remortgaging As the mortgage landscape continues to shift, understanding when and how to remortgage is crucial. The podcast highlights a significant hurdle: desktop valuations can undervalue properties, pushing clients into unfavorable loan-to-value brackets. With this risk, borrowers are encouraged to be proactive in challenging these valuations, especially if they can provide evidence of home improvements. Those approaching the end of a fixed deal should ideally start exploring options three months prior and consider locking in rates early to secure financial peace of mind. High-Net-Worth Borrowers: A Different Story For those seeking million-pound mortgages, the same FCA rules apply. However, this demographic often receives tailored advice through specialist "premier teams." Although high-net-worth individuals are less impacted by rising living costs, the necessity for rigorous income validation remains, particularly for self-employed clients, demonstrating that transparency is key across borrower categories. Avoiding Common Buyer Mistakes One critical takeaway from the episode is the common pitfall of making offers without a clear understanding of one's financial limits. Online calculators often yield misleading results. To regroup, working with an experienced mortgage broker should be your first step. They can help clarify your true borrowing power and monthly commitments, ensuring informed decision-making. Shattering Mortgage Myths Many buyers operate under the assumption that lenders are rigid and unapproachable. The podcast debunks this myth, revealing that good financial habits, such as timely bill payments, consistent savings, and reliable rental history, actually enhance mortgage applications. Some niche products, like Skipton's 100% mortgage scheme for renters with commendable financial histories, exemplify the options available for the diligent borrower. Looking Ahead: What to Expect in 2025 Experts are optimistic about the future of the mortgage industry, predicting potential further cuts to the base rate. A drop below 4%, and possibly to 3%, could be on the horizon as inflation trends evolve. The ensuing outlook for 2025 is cautiously hopeful. Lenders appear ready to engage with borrowers, creating a more conducive environment for those prepared to act. Buyers are encouraged to keep their financials orderly and consult brokers well ahead of their applications.
